Danang Setyadi is a scholar working on Education, Applied Mathematics and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Danang Setyadi has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 130 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 22 papers in Education, 17 papers in Applied Mathematics and 14 papers in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Danang Setyadi’s work include Mathematics Education and Pedagogy (17 papers), STEM Education (16 papers) and Educational Methods and Media Use (14 papers). Danang Setyadi is often cited by papers focused on Mathematics Education and Pedagogy (17 papers), STEM Education (16 papers) and Educational Methods and Media Use (14 papers). Danang Setyadi collaborates with scholars based in Indonesia. Danang Setyadi's co-authors include Abd. Qohar, Krisma Widi Wardani and Helti Lygia Mampouw and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Education, DOAJ (DOAJ: Directory of Open Access Journals) and Scholaria Jurnal Pendidikan dan Kebudayaan.
